What is Underground Service Locating?
Underground service locating uses specialised equipment and techniques to detect and map subsurface utilities before excavation work begins. This process identifies the location, depth, and type of underground services including:
- Electrical cables and power lines
- Gas pipelines
- Water mains and sewer lines
- Telecommunications cables (phone, internet, fibre optic)
- Stormwater drains
- Private utility services

The Hidden Dangers of Digging Without Locating
Safety Risks
Striking an underground utility can have catastrophic consequences:
Gas lines: Risk of explosion, fire, and evacuation of surrounding areas
Electrical cables: Electrocution hazards for workers and equipment operators
Water mains: Flooding, property damage, and potential collapse of excavation sites
Telecommunications: Service disruption affecting entire communities
Financial Consequences
The cost of a utility strike extends far beyond the immediate repair:
- Emergency repair costs (often tens of thousands of dollars)
- Project delays and downtime
- Potential fines and penalties for non-compliance
- Increased insurance premiums
- Legal liability for damages
- Loss of reputation and future contracts
Legal and Compliance Issues
In Queensland and NSW, excavators have a legal duty to take reasonable steps to locate underground services before digging. Failure to do so can result in:
- Substantial fines from regulatory authorities
- Breach of workplace health and safety obligations
- Criminal charges in cases of serious injury or death
- Liability for third-party damages
How Underground Service Locating Works
1.
Dial Before You Dig
The first step in any excavation project should be contacting Dial Before You Dig (1100). This free service provides plans showing the approximate location of underground utilities from participating asset owners.
However, these plans have limitations:
-
- They show approximate locations, not exact positions
-
- Accuracy can vary, especially for older infrastructure
-
- Private services may not be included
-
- Depths are often not indicated
2.
Professional Locating Services
This is where specialized underground locating services become essential. At Top Vac Services, we use professional-grade equipment including:
Electromagnetic Locators: Detect metallic utilities like gas pipes, water mains, and electrical cables by tracing electromagnetic signals.
Ground Penetrating Radar (GPR): Uses radar pulses to create images of subsurface structures, effective for locating non-metallic utilities like PVC pipes and fibre optic cables.
Cable Locators: Trace specific cables and pipes by applying a signal and tracking it along the utility path.
3.
Physical Verification
The safest approach combines electronic locating with non-destructive digging methods like vacuum excavation to physically verify the location and depth of services before full-scale excavation begins.

Best Practices for Underground Service Locating
1. Always Start with Dial Before You Dig
Even if you’re planning to use professional locating services, always lodge a Dial Before You Dig enquiry. This provides baseline information and fulfills your legal obligations.
2. Engage Professional Locators Early
Don’t wait until the excavator is on-site. Engage locating services during the planning phase to identify potential conflicts and adjust designs if necessary.
3. Mark and Document Everything
Professional locators will mark service locations with paint or flags. Document these markings with photos and measurements for reference throughout the project.
4. Use Non-Destructive Digging Near Services
Even with accurate locating, use vacuum excavation preferably, or hand digging when working within 300mm of identified services. This provides an extra safety margin.
5. Expect the Unexpected
Not all services are documented or detectable. Maintain vigilance throughout excavation and stop work immediately if you encounter unexpected utilities.
The Cost of Not Locating: A Cautionary Tale
The cost of professional underground service locating is minimal compared to the potential consequences of a utility strike:
- Professional locating service: Hundreds of dollars
- Vacuum excavation verification: Additional hundreds to low thousands
- Average cost of a utility strike: $50,000 – $100,000+
- Cost of a major gas or electrical incident: Potentially millions
